C46 URP is a 1986 Land Rover 110 in Green with a 2,496cc diesel engine. This vehicle has been through 24 MOT tests with a personal pass rate of 66.7%.
Across all 1986 Land Rover 110 models, the average MOT pass rate is 71.9% with a typical mileage of 123,954 miles. This particular vehicle has a lower pass rate than the average for its year, which may indicate maintenance issues worth investigating.
The most common reason a Land Rover 110 fails its MOT is brake pipe excessively corroded, accounting for 450 recorded failures. If you're considering buying C46 URP, it's worth having these areas checked by a mechanic before committing.
The Land Rover 110 typically stays on UK roads for around 55 years. At 40 years old, this Land Rover 110 is well into its expected lifespan but still has years ahead.
